Description

A memoir from a retired Irish priest and radio personality. Fr. Collins takes the reader on an enjoyable and humorous journey, through many broadcasts, articles, scripts and even obituaries. Fr. Collins spent eighteen years in charge of the Bogside parish of Longtower during the Troubles.
